Abstract

The invention discloses a sampling needle washing device which comprises a swab and a rotor installed in an inner cavity. The swab is provided with the inner cavity, and a liquid inlet and a liquid outlet are formed in the side wall of the swab. The rotor is provided with a washing cavity allowing a sampling needle to be inserted in, at least one blade is arranged on the outer side of the rotor, at least one liquid communicating port is formed in the side wall of the rotor, and the inner cavity and the washing cavity communicate with each other through the liquid communicating ports. The sampling needle is inserted in the washing cavity, washing liquid flows into the inner cavity through the liquid inlet and then flows away through the liquid outlet, the washing liquid flows in the inner cavity in a fixed direction and drives the rotor to rotate, the washing liquid in the inner cavity flows into the washing cavity through the liquid communicating ports, and the washing liquid in the washing cavity is driven by the rotor to scour the sampling needle in all directions. By the adoption of the sampling needle washing device, a washing effect is greatly improved, and the probability ofcross infection of sampling needles is reduced.

Description

technical field [0001] The invention relates to a sampling needle cleaning device in the field of medical testing instruments. Background technique [0002] During the use of the chromatography technology analyzer, after the sampling needle draws the blood sample in the test tube, the blood sample is left on the inner and outer surfaces of the needle to avoid cross-contamination and affect the next test, and the residual blood on the sampling needle needs to be cleaned . At present, the cleaning methods commonly used in the market are to use flowing liquid to wash away the residual liquid on the pipe wall, or directly use a pressure washing device to wash directly, but only a certain part or angle of the surface of the sampling needle can be cleaned, which is different. To a certain extent, the cleaning is not clean, and the risk of cross-contamination is relatively high.
